Abstract: | In this paper, we describe an e-commerce teamwork-based project designed and implemented at the Hong Kong Polytechnic University (PolyU) for undergraduate business and management students. The teaching objectives of this e-commerce project are to develop the students’ knowledge and skills, such as in the use of e-commerce site building tools, critical thinking, communication skills, teamwork, and entrepreneurship. We focus on the practical implications of the project-based teamwork approach in the teaching and learning of introductory e-commerce from a business context perspective. The results of an evaluation indicate that the project-based teamwork approach to teaching e-commerce performs to expectations. Our experience and student evaluations indicate that students like the practical components of the course and are interested in the use of the learning-by-doing approach. We believe that other business colleges with e-commerce curricula will benefit from this approach. |
